Create pages or blog posts in Confluence Cloud for new documents in Google Docs folder
Keep your team's Confluence Cloud content fresh with new material each time there's a new document added to a specific Google Docs folder. This workflow takes the hassle out of manually copying from Google Docs to Confluence Cloud by automatically creating a new page or blog post. It's an efficient way to ensure updated information is always accessible.
